Building a Foundation: Faith and Values

One essential facet the Bible emphasizes in terms of courting is the significance of shared faith and values. In 2 Corinthians 6:14, it says, "Do not be unequally yoked with unbelievers. For what partnership has righteousness with lawlessness? Or what fellowship has gentle with darkness?"

This verse encourages believers to seek partners who share their religion and values. It highlights the significance of getting a strong foundation in a relationship to ensure unity, mutual understanding, and shared spiritual development.

However, it’s necessary to notice that this verse isn’t meant to encourage judgment or exclusion. Honoring Boundaries: Purity and Respect

Another key component highlighted within the Bible regarding courting is the importance of honoring boundaries, each physical and emotional. In 1 Thessalonians four:3-5, it states, "For that is the will of God, your sanctification: that you just abstain from sexual immorality; that every one of you know how to manage his own physique in holiness and honor, not within the ardour of lust like the Gentiles who have no idea God."

This verse emphasizes the value of purity and self-control in relationships. It encourages people to treat their partners with respect and to prioritize their emotional and bodily well-being. By setting boundaries and abstaining from sexual immorality, we are able to domesticate a foundation of trust and honor inside a courting relationship.

FAQ

  1. What does the Bible say about relationship and relationships?

    • The Bible doesn’t specifically point out courting; nevertheless, it provides principles and tips for wholesome relationships. It emphasizes the significance of mutual respect, love, and commitment in relationships and encourages believers to pursue relationships with people who share their faith and values (2 Corinthians 6:14, 1 Corinthians 13:4-7).
  2. Is premarital sex allowed in a relationship relationship based on the Bible?

    • The Bible clearly teaches that sexual intimacy is reserved for marriage. It is known as the physical union between a husband and spouse and is meant to be a sacred and exclusive bond (1 Corinthians 6:18-20, Hebrews 13:4). Therefore, premarital intercourse is considered contrary to God’s design for relationships.
  3. How does the Bible outline the function of men and women in dating relationships?

    • The Bible teaches that men are called to love and lead their partners as Christ loved the church by sacrificially serving and caring for them (Ephesians 5:25-29). Women, on the opposite hand, are inspired to respect and undergo their partners’ management inside the context of a loving and mutually supportive relationship (Ephesians 5:22-24).
  4. Can Christians date non-believers?

    • While the Bible doesn’t explicitly forbid relationship non-believers, it advises towards being unequally yoked with unbelievers (2 Corinthians 6:14). This passage means that believers ought to prioritize discovering a life associate who shares their faith and values to keep away from conflicts and differing non secular priorities in the relationship.
  5. Are there any biblical tips for successful dating?

    • The Bible offers a quantity of pointers for successful relationship, together with seeking God’s steering and knowledge in decision-making (Proverbs three:5-6), treating others with love, respect, and integrity (Ephesians 4:2, 1 Corinthians thirteen:4-7), avoiding sexual immorality and impurity (1 Thessalonians 4:3-5), and working towards self-control and persistence (Galatians 5:22-23).
